Quick Summary

The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), Network Contract Office 10, is soliciting bids for Project 515-15-117, "Replace Electrical Primary Distribution" at the Battle Creek, MI VA Medical Center. This project involves replacing the existing primary electrical distribution system. This acquisition is a 100%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) Set-Aside. The estimated magnitude of construction is between $10,000,000 and $20,000,000. Sealed bids are due by June 18, 2026, at 12:00 PM EDT.

Scope of Work

The contractor will be responsible for providing all labor, materials, supervision, and equipment necessary to complete the project. Key tasks include:

  • Removal of trees and vegetation.
  • Excavation for duct banks and electrical equipment pads.
  • Installation of conduit in concrete encased duct banks.
  • Installation of switchgear and transformers.
  • Exterior restoration.
  • Demolition and removal of existing electrical wire, equipment, concrete, and masonry.
  • Project completion in multiple phases as outlined in specifications and drawings.
  • All work must comply with manufacturer recommendations, applicable codes, and building standards.

Contract Details

  • Contract Type: Firm-Fixed-Price.
  • NAICS Code: 238210 – Electrical Contractors and Other Wiring Installation Contractors, with a small business size standard of $19.0 million.
  • Place of Performance: Battle Creek, MI VA Medical Center, 5500 Armstrong Rd, Battle Creek, Michigan 49037.

Submission & Evaluation

  • Bid Due Date: June 18, 2026, at 12:00 PM EDT.
  • Submission Requirements: Bids must be submitted as original, completed, signed, and dated SF 1442 Offer pages ('wet ink signature'). A Bid Bond (SF 24) or other allowable Bid Security is required. Offerors must acknowledge all amendments.
  • Site Visit: A site visit is scheduled for May 27, 2026, at 10:00 am.
  • Questions (RFIs) Due: June 3, 2026.
  • Eligibility: This is a 100% SDVOSB Set-Aside. Prospective contractors must have an active registration in SAM.gov and be verified in the SBA’s Dynamic Small Business Search (DSBS). A current VETS4212 report must also be on file.
  • Bonds: Performance and Payment Bonds are required for awards over $35,000 and $150,000 respectively.
  • Safety: Bidders must submit a Pre-Award Contractor Experience Modification Rate (EMR) Form, including OSHA 300/300a forms and an insurance carrier letter, to demonstrate safety records.
  • Subcontracting: A mandatory VAAR 852.219-75 "Notice of Limitations on Subcontracting—Certificate of Compliance" must be submitted, certifying that for general construction, not more than 85% of the contract amount will be paid to non-SDVOSB/VOSB firms.
